Buy it or you'll be sorry! The .358 is a fine round that will take care of anything in N. America, Europe, and plains game of Africa. As has been well stated, no need for expensive boutique bullets as the cup and core gets the job done. I use my own cast bullets in 7.62 cases and have never been disappointed. As much as I admire the 7x57, the .358 isn't very far behind.
 
I sat down at the loading bench last night and put together 300 rounds of .358 Win with 50.0 grains of W748 and 200 grain Hornady SP's at 2.725"... this is a proven load with dozens of heads of game under its "belt." It is my general use load in the .358... I do have a stouter load and bullet for big bears, but for the most part, this is not required.
